Rothesay is the UK’s largest pensions insurance specialist, purpose-built to protect pension schemes and their members’ pensions. With over £68 billion of assets under management, we secure the pensions of more than one million people and pay out, on average, approximately £200 million in pension payments each month. Rothesay is dedicated to providing excellence in customer service alongside prudent underwriting, a conservative investment strategy and the careful management of risk.
We are trusted by the pension schemes of some of the UK’s best known companies to provide pension solutions, including British Airways, Cadbury, the Civil Aviation Authority, the Co-Operative, Morrisons, Smiths Industries and Telent. What you will do
Rothesay’s investment philosophy is to decrease credit risk through obtaining collateral, credit protection or other structural security in the assets in which it invests thereby, in the event an asset defaults, increasing recovery and avoiding credit losses. This role will be to join the existing members of the assets legal team in providing high quality commercially focussed legal advice to the asset origination team in its pursuit and management of assets meeting this philosophy. The primary focus of the role will be real estate finance but the role will also provide the opportunity to work on pure real estate investment projects, as well as a wide variety of asset financing transactions including general finance, structured finance, capital markets and derivatives in an intellectually challenging and engaging environment. It will also provide an opportunity to get involved in regulatory advice/analysis.
Key activities include:
- To assist with the execution of a wide variety of investments meeting Rothesay’s investment philosophy.
- To provide efficient, effective and high quality legal advice in a commercially focussed way to the assets team which will include advising on, reviewing and negotiating terms sheets, transaction documentation, real estate due diligence, non-disclosure agreements and dealing with general queries on existing and potential investments.
- To manage business as usual queries, projects and 'random queries' on existing assets with care and high standards of customer service (whilst tailoring advice to the commercial situation and materiality).
- Assist in the interpretation of the regulatory rules which apply to insurance companies and the assets in which they invest and assisting in ensuring Rothesay’s compliance with them.
- Co-ordinating and instructing external legal counsel in connection with all the above.
